Abstract
We describe a novel snapshot imaging polarimeter based on off-axis digital holographic scheme. The proposed digital holographic imaging polarimeter is based on a compact interferometric module and it requires neither moving parts nor time dependent modulation. From a snapshot polarizing digital hologram, we can reconstruct a spatially resolved polarimetric phase image with moderate precision and accuracy. The real time capability of the proposed digital holographic imaging polarimeter is demonstrated by using a nano-patterned transmissive object.
